This family farm is located in northeast Madison County only a few minutes southeast of downtown Fredericktown. In its current state, this farm is a deer hunters paradise. The 20 acres of creek bottom fields have not been touched in over 6 years and the natural regeneration that is occurring has turned this place into a bedding hotspot for all wildlife in the area. With the spring-fed creek running through the property the only thing you need is the easy addition of a few food plots and you would definitely have a deer and turkey hunting honey hole year after year. The property has good access off of Highway Z, so it would also serve well as a home building spot or with some improvements made to the fencing it could be put back into cattle production. Property Features:

- 1.5 miles southeast of Fredericktown, 1.5 hours south of St Louis. On CR 258, only 1/4 mile off of Highway Z
- 100 acres consisting of 80 acres of hardwood timber, mixed with pines, and 20 acres of fields
- Small spring fed creek runs through property year-round
- Small 2 room log cabin, previously used for deer camp
- 1 nice elevated shooting house
- Thick bedding cover everywhere, the natural regeneration that has occurred on this property over the last 6 years has turned it into a wildlife sanctuary. Great deer and turkey hunting opportunities
- Gated entrance, with some old fencing. Trail system through the property
- Asking $1595/acre
- Electric is readily available, many great building spots
- Annual taxes are $72.00
